Improve Your Credit Score
Your credit score is like a report card for your money habits. It tells lenders if you pay on time. A good credit score for a business loan is very important. A score of 680 or higher is a good goal. To make your score better:
- Pay all your bills on time.
- Pay down your credit card balances.
- Do not open new credit cards.
A better score can get you a better interest rate on a loan.
Get Your Documents Ready
Lenders want a complete story of your business. They want to see papers that prove your story is real. The documents needed for a business loan are key. You will need:
- Business financial statements for loans: These are like a photo of your business's money. They show how much you earn and how much you spend.
- Business tax returns: Lenders will look at your last two years of tax returns.
- Bank statements: These show your money coming in and going out.
- Business plan: This shows what your business does and where you want to go.

Keep Your Debt Low
Lenders look at how much debt you have. This is called your debt-to-income ratio for business loans. They want to see that your business can pay back a new loan without problems.
